Correcting Covariates for Unreliability

Abstract:
Data from the national evaluation of Project Follow Through were analyzed using analy sis of covariance with and without correcting the pretest for unreliability. Such corrections led to some changes in conclusions about the performance of various educational models funded under Follow Through. Although the results of both sets of analyses were pre sented in the Follow Through evaluators' report, conclusions were based on the analyses employing the uncorrected pretest due to the many disagreements in the literature about the appropriateness of correction for unreliability.
